How to Learn Data Analytics Step by Step Using SQL, Python, Pandas, and Power BI?
Data analytics is the structured process of collecting, cleaning, analyzing, and visualizing data to support business decision-making. It combines database querying (SQL), programming and data manipulation (Python, Pandas, NumPy), statistical analysis, and visualization tools (Power BI, Tableau) to transform raw data into actionable insights. A step-by-step learning approach focuses on understanding data sources, applying analytical techniques, and communicating results through dashboards and reports.
What Is Data Analytics?
Data analytics is the discipline of examining datasets to identify patterns, trends, relationships, and anomalies that inform operational, financial, and strategic decisions.
In enterprise environments, data analytics typically involves:
Extracting data from relational databases or data warehouses
Cleaning and transforming data to ensure accuracy and consistency
Applying descriptive or diagnostic analysis
Visualizing findings in dashboards or reports for stakeholders
Unlike data science, which often emphasizes predictive modeling and advanced machine learning, data analytics focuses on business reporting, performance analysis, and operational insights.
Why Is Data Analytics Important for Working Professionals?
Data analytics is widely used across IT, finance, healthcare, retail, manufacturing, and consulting environments. For working professionals, analytics skills support:
Data-driven decision-making instead of intuition-based judgments
Improved reporting accuracy and transparency
Better communication between technical teams and business stakeholders
Career mobility across roles that rely on data interpretation
Many professionals pursue Data analytics certification courses or an online data analytics certificate to formalize these skills and demonstrate competency to employers.
What Skills Are Required to Learn Data Analytics?
Learning data analytics requires a combination of technical, analytical, and communication skills. For beginner-to-intermediate IT professionals, the core skill areas include:
SQL fundamentals for querying structured data
Python programming basics for automation and analysis
Pandas and NumPy for data manipulation
Data visualization tools such as Power BI or Tableau
Basic statistics for understanding trends and distributions
Business context awareness to interpret results meaningfully
These skills are often covered in structured data analyst online classes or data analytics certification programs.
How Does SQL Work in Real-World Data Analytics Projects?
SQL is the foundation of most enterprise data analytics workflows because it is used to interact directly with relational databases.
In production environments, analysts use SQL to:
Retrieve filtered datasets from large transactional systems
Aggregate metrics such as revenue, usage, or performance indicators
Join multiple tables to create analysis-ready datasets
Validate data consistency and integrity
A typical SQL workflow involves:
Identifying relevant tables and fields
Writing SELECT queries with WHERE, GROUP BY, and JOIN clauses
Creating views or temporary tables for repeatable analysis
Exporting query results for further processing in Python or BI tools
SQL is commonly used with systems such as PostgreSQL, MySQL, SQL Server, Oracle, and cloud data warehouses.
How Is Python Used in Data Analytics?
Python is used in data analytics for tasks that go beyond database querying, especially when automation, transformation, or statistical analysis is required.
In real-world analytics projects, Python supports:
Data cleaning and normalization
Handling missing or inconsistent values
Combining data from multiple sources (CSV, APIs, databases)
Reproducible analysis workflows using scripts or notebooks
Python’s readability and extensive ecosystem make it suitable for collaborative analytics environments.
What Role Do Pandas and NumPy Play in Analytics Workflows?
Pandas and NumPy are core Python libraries used for data manipulation and numerical analysis.
Pandas is typically used to:
Load datasets into DataFrame structures
Filter, sort, and group data
Perform aggregations and calculations
Prepare datasets for visualization or reporting
NumPy supports:
Efficient numerical computations
Array-based operations
Mathematical functions used in analytics pipelines
In enterprise settings, analysts often:
Pull data using SQL
Load it into Pandas DataFrames
Perform transformations and calculations
Export results to visualization tools or reporting systems
How Do Power BI and Tableau Support Business Intelligence?
Power BI and Tableau are business intelligence (BI) tools used to convert analyzed data into visual insights.
They are commonly used to:
Build dashboards for executive and operational reporting
Track key performance indicators (KPIs)
Enable self-service analytics for non-technical users
Connect to live data sources or scheduled extracts
In enterprise environments, Power BI is frequently integrated with:
SQL databases and cloud data platforms
Excel and CSV-based reporting systems
Role-based access controls and governance frameworks
Visualization tools emphasize clarity, consistency, and usability rather than advanced modeling.
How Is Data Analytics Used in Enterprise Environments?
In enterprise IT projects, data analytics is part of a larger data ecosystem that includes:
Source systems (ERP, CRM, transaction platforms)
Data integration tools (ETL pipelines)
Data warehouses or lakes
Analytics and BI layers
Analytics teams often work under constraints such as:
Data security and access control policies
Performance limitations on production databases
Regulatory requirements for data handling
Version control and documentation standards
Best practices include:
Separating analytical queries from transactional systems
Validating data sources before analysis
Maintaining reproducible and auditable workflows
What Job Roles Use Data Analytics Daily?
Data analytics skills are used across multiple roles, including:
Data Analyst
Business Analyst
BI Analyst
Operations Analyst
Financial Analyst
Product Analyst
In these roles, professionals regularly:
Analyze performance metrics
Identify trends and outliers
Prepare reports for stakeholders
Support decision-making with data evidence
Many employers expect candidates to have completed a data analytics certificate online or equivalent structured training.
What Careers Are Possible After Learning Data Analytics?
After completing data analytics training, professionals may pursue roles such as:
Junior or Associate Data Analyst
Business Intelligence Analyst
Reporting Analyst
Analytics Consultant
Domain-specific analyst roles (finance, healthcare, marketing)
Career progression often depends on:
Depth of SQL and Python expertise
Ability to translate data into business insights
Experience with enterprise BI tools
Understanding of industry-specific data
An online data analytics certificate can help validate foundational skills but is typically complemented by hands-on project experience.
Step-by-Step Learning Path for Data Analytics
A structured learning approach helps reduce complexity and improves retention.
A practical step-by-step sequence includes:
Understanding data types and sources
Learning SQL for querying structured datasets
Building Python fundamentals
Applying Pandas and NumPy for data manipulation
Performing basic statistical analysis
Creating dashboards using Power BI or Tableau
Interpreting and communicating results
This progression aligns with how analytics skills are applied in real-world projects.
Common Challenges When Learning Data Analytics
Professionals often encounter challenges such as:
Difficulty translating business questions into queries
Managing inconsistent or incomplete data
Understanding performance trade-offs in SQL queries
Designing clear and meaningful visualizations
Explaining technical findings to non-technical audiences
Structured data analyst online classes typically address these challenges through guided exercises and real datasets.
Frequently Asked Questions (FAQ)
Is a data analytics certification necessary?
A certification is not mandatory but can help demonstrate structured learning and foundational competence, especially for career transitions.
How long does it take to learn data analytics?
For working professionals, foundational skills typically require several months of consistent study and hands-on practice.
Do I need programming experience to start?
No advanced programming experience is required. Basic logical thinking and willingness to practice are sufficient.
Which tool should I learn first: SQL or Python?
SQL is usually learned first because it is essential for accessing structured data in enterprise systems.
Are Power BI and Tableau interchangeable?
They serve similar purposes but differ in ecosystem integration and deployment models. Learning one makes it easier to adapt to the other.
Key Takeaways
Data analytics focuses on extracting insights from structured data for decision-making
SQL, Python, Pandas, and Power BI form a practical enterprise analytics toolkit
Structured learning improves clarity and skill transfer
Analytics skills are used across multiple business and IT roles
Certification supports learning but practical application is essential
To gain hands-on experience and structured guidance, explore H2K Infosys Online data analytics certificate courses designed for working professionals.
These programs focus on practical skills, real tools, and career-relevant learning paths.

Comments
Post a Comment